Key Insights of Japan Continuously Variable Tractor Market

  •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$1.2 billion, reflecting steady adoption driven by modernization efforts.
  • Forecast Value (2026–2033): Projected to reach $2.4 billion, with a CAGR of around 10%, driven by technological advancements and government incentives.
  • Leading Segment: Compact and mid-range CVTs dominate, accounting for over 65% of total sales, favored by smallholder and commercial farms.
  • Core Application: Precision agriculture and sustainable farming practices are primary drivers, with CVTs enabling enhanced efficiency and crop yields.
  • Leading Geography: The Kanto and Kansai regions hold over 50% market share, owing to dense agricultural activity and infrastructure support.
  • Key Market Opportunity: Integration of IoT and AI in CVT systems presents a significant growth avenue, especially for smart farming initiatives.
  • Major Companies: Kubota, Yanmar, and Iseki are the dominant players, investing heavily in R&D and strategic partnerships.

Market Dynamics of Japan Continuously Variable Tractor Market

The Japanese agricultural machinery landscape is characterized by a mature yet innovation-driven market, with CVT technology increasingly embedded in modern tractors. The sector benefits from a robust ecosystem of OEMs, technology providers, and government agencies promoting sustainable farming. Market growth is fueled by a combination of aging farm equipment, labor shortages, and a push toward precision agriculture to enhance productivity.

Technological evolution, including hybrid CVT systems and AI-powered controls, is reshaping the competitive landscape. The adoption rate varies across regions, with urban-adjacent areas witnessing faster uptake due to higher farm mechanization levels. Regulatory frameworks emphasizing emission reduction and energy efficiency further accelerate the transition toward advanced CVT systems. While the market is relatively consolidated, emerging startups focusing on IoT integration and automation are challenging incumbents, fostering a dynamic innovation environment.

Japan Continuously Variable Tractor Market: Regulatory and Environmental Influences

Japan’s regulatory environment significantly influences the CVT tractor market, with strict emission standards and energy efficiency mandates driving innovation. The government’s Green Growth Strategy emphasizes sustainable agriculture, incentivizing the adoption of eco-friendly machinery. Policies promoting smart farming and digital transformation further support the integration of IoT-enabled CVTs.

Environmental concerns, including climate change and resource conservation, are compelling farmers to adopt more efficient machinery. The push toward renewable energy sources and hybrid systems aligns with national targets for carbon neutrality, influencing R&D priorities. Additionally, subsidies and tax incentives for adopting advanced, low-emission equipment are accelerating market penetration. These policies collectively create a favorable environment for technological innovation and market expansion.

Emerging Trends and Innovation Drivers in Japan’s CVT Tractor Market

Technological innovation is at the core of Japan’s CVT tractor evolution, with a focus on hybrid systems, AI integration, and IoT connectivity. The adoption of smart sensors and machine learning algorithms enhances operational efficiency, predictive maintenance, and crop management. The integration of GPS and telematics enables precision farming, reducing input costs and environmental impact.

Market players are investing heavily in R&D to develop lightweight, energy-efficient CVT systems compatible with electric and hybrid powertrains. The rise of autonomous tractor prototypes and remote operation capabilities signals a shift toward fully automated farming solutions. These trends are driven by the need to address labor shortages, improve sustainability, and meet stringent regulatory standards, positioning Japan as a pioneer in advanced CVT tractor technology.
